Stone Age Parents Didn't Have Cribs—Here's What They Did Instead
How did Stone Age babies survive without cribs, hospitals, clean bottles, or modern safety? In this video, you’ll discover how ancient humans kept babies alive in the wild using warmth, breastfeeding, shared care, fire, soft food, grandmothers, older siblings, and the power of the group. For most of human history, a baby was not raised by one person alone. Survival depended on cooperation, attention, and a whole community protecting its most fragile member.
